The Boston Bruins and Washington Capitals are playing their season opener on Wednesday. Both teams made it to the playoffs last season but didn't reach their ultimate goal of winning the Stanley Cup.

The Boston Bruins split their six preseason games, winning three and losing three. They are expected to start the season without leading scorer Brad Marchand and two solid defensemen in Matt Grzelcyk and Charlie McAvoy. David Krejci is rejoining the team and younger players such as Jack Studnicka and Marc McLaughlin could appear at some point.

Washington Capitals won four out of six preseason games. They allowed three goals in their final game. Alex Ovechkin led the team in points with 90 last season. Nicklas Backstrom, Carl Hagelin and Tom Wilson are out. Boston Bruins take on the Washington Capitals on Wednesday.

Bruins won two of three meetings with the Capitals last season.

Bruins vs. Capitals is a game on Wednesday, October 12 at 7 p.m. ET. The game is being played at the Capital One Arena in Washington, DC.
